Possible causes:

1. One or more speaker is shorted internally or externally
2. An amp malfunctuion
3. Wiring

To fix it, find someone with an ohm meter (and who knows how to use it) to check the speaker's impedances and check out the amp.

This is a safety feature of your amp. It generally means there is a fault in your system. If you have only just connected your amp it can mean a number of things like a bad connection or possibly an internal fault within amp.
